Outline of Final Research Achievements |
We conducted an in vitro study using human aortic endothelial cells (EC)-smooth muscle cells (SMC) coculture model to investigate cellular interactions associated with blood vessel pathophysiology under WSS conditions. In this study, we newly constructed a coculture model with centrifugally compressed cell-collagen combined construct (C6), which withstands higher WSS conditions. The expression of a-smooth muscle actin (αSMA) in SMAs was significantly increased in the C6 coculture model exposed to WSS of 2 Pa compared with that of cells in the SMC monoculture model at 2 Pa and those in the C6 coculture model exposed to the 20 Pa condition. Similarly, WSS conditions of 2 and 20 Pa also induced different expression ratios of matrix metalloproteinases and their inhibitors in the C6 coculture model, but did not in monocultured ECs and SMCs. Our data suggested that WSS related-signaling transduced by ECs may lead to morphological and functional changes of SMCs.

Academic Significance and Societal Importance of the Research Achievements |
大動脈弁二尖弁は頻度の高い先天性心疾患で約半数で上行大動脈が拡大するが、その機序は十分に解明されていない。今回、大動脈血管内皮細胞と大動脈血管平滑筋細胞の単培養モデルも作成し、これらを対照群とした実験を行うことで、血行力学ストレスに曝露される環境下で血管内皮細胞によるsignal transductionを介し、血管平滑筋細胞における機能的・形態的変化が間接的に誘発される可能性が示された。大動脈二尖弁症例は、解離や破裂などの重篤な大動脈疾患の発生頻度が高いことが報告されているが、本研究成果は、治療成績向上につながる創薬および新規バイオマーカー開発につながる可能性を有する。
